Bu127 chap 13 - analyzing financial statements. Users of statements: management: uses accounting data to make product pricing and expansion decisions, external decision makers: uses accounting data for investment, credit, tax and public policy decision. Three types of statement info: past performance: income, sales volume, cash flows, roi, eps, present condition: assets, debt, inventory, various ratios, future performance: sales and earnings trends are good indicator of future performance. Statement analysis is based on comparisons: time series analysis: examines a single company to identify trends over time, comparisons with similar companies: provides insights concerning a company"s relative position. Component percentages: express each item on a particular statement as a percentage of a single base amount: net sales on income statement.
